Cost for order circulate is compensation obtained by a brokerage firm for routing retail buy and promote orders to a specific market maker, who takes the other facet of the order. (In different words, market makers become the vendor to your purchase order or buyer to your sell order). In December 2022, the SEC proposed modifications to Rule 605 to boost the disclosure of order execution info for buyers. The proposed updates apply to broker-dealers handling more than a hundred,000 buyer accounts, extending the rule’s reach past market centers to include a bigger portion of retail-facing corporations. Cost for order circulate (PFOF) signifies that retail brokerages are compensated by market makers for sending clients’ orders to the market maker instead of the stock change.

Analyzing variations within the PFOF received from a given wholesaler, the lack of PI at Robinhood is explained by the amount of PFOF acquired. For example, Susquehanna pays TD Ameritrade $0.10 per hundred shares and delivers mid-price execution. In distinction, the identical wholesaler pays Robinhood $0.seventy five per hundred shares and delivers zero price https://www.xcritical.com/ improvement. This means that Robinhood’s agreements with wholesalers sacrifice PI in trade for increased PFOF—exactly the conflict of curiosity that Chairman Gensler has expressed considerations about. Brokers are required to disclose certain details about their order routing in what is called a Rule 606 report. This report discloses the details of how a lot PFOF was obtained from wholesalers, together with the breakdown of order sorts.
